WebL'iponatriemia è una diminuzione della concentrazione sierica di sodio < 136 mEq/L ( < 136 mmol/L) causata da un eccesso di acqua rispetto al soluto. Cause frequenti comprendono uso di diuretici, diarrea, insufficienza cardiaca, malattia epatica, malattia renale e la sindrome da secrezione inappropriata dell'ormone antidiuretico. This causes your body to lose electrolytes, such as sodium, and also increases ADH levels. Drinking too much water. Drinking excessive amounts of water can cause low sodium by overwhelming the kidneys' ability to excrete water.
